The monastery garden, which previously served as a fruit and vegetable garden for the monastery tenant, was converted into a monastery park in 1965. Students from the Technical University of Hanover (Horticulture Faculty) took on the planning of the redesign as part of a competition. During a sculpture symposium in 1984, several sculptures were placed in the monastery park. Among them was a wooden figure of the patron saint of the Lamspringe monastery church, St. Dionysius. The park thus also serves as an "open-air museum". Skates must be taken off when walking through the park - the paths are not asphalted. Frequently Asked Questions

What types of natural monuments can I explore around Harbarnsen?

Around Harbarnsen, you can discover a variety of natural monuments, including historic springs like Apenteich Spring, impressive rock formations such as the Gerzer Cliffs and Selter Cliffs, and panoramic viewpoints like the Ernst-Binnewies Tower (Tafelbergturm) on Hohe Tafel. The region also features river valleys and protected landscapes within the scenic Hildesheim district.

Are there any family-friendly natural attractions near Harbarnsen?

Yes, several natural monuments are suitable for families. Apenteich Spring is a charming spot in the forest, and Klosterpark Lamspringe offers a park setting with minigolf and a monastery mill, making it enjoyable for all ages.

What historical or cultural significance do these natural monuments hold?

Some natural monuments around Harbarnsen have historical roots. Apenteich Spring is a historic alpine pond spring where Bronze Age finds have been discovered. Klosterpark Lamspringe, while a natural area, is associated with the historical Lamspringe Abbey and features a working monastery mill.

Are there any natural monuments that offer good views?

Yes, for panoramic views, visit the Ernst-Binnewies Tower (Tafelbergturm) on Hohe Tafel. This 19-meter-high observation tower provides extensive views of Alfeld, Brüggen, and the Leinebergland. The Selter Cliffs also offer impressive views from their crest trail.

What is special about the Apenteich Spring?

The Apenteich Spring is a very charming and historic site. It features alpine pond springs and has yielded finds from the Bronze Age. Many visitors appreciate its excellent water quality and find it a wonderful place to unwind in the forest, near the ruins of Winzenburg Castle.

Are there any climbing opportunities at the natural monuments?

Yes, the Gerzer Cliffs are known as a practice rock for climbers. They are located directly on the Ith-Hils hiking trail, and while popular with climbers, hikers can also enjoy the beautiful cliff formations without climbing.

What can I expect to see at the Selter Cliffs?

The Selter Cliffs offer a crest trail with fantastic views. It's a nature reserve protecting unique canyon and hillside mixed forests, moss and fern vegetation, and the cliffs themselves, which serve as habitats for threatened bird species and bats. Visitors are asked to stay on designated paths to help preserve this natural environment.

Are there any natural monuments that are particularly good for wildlife spotting?

The Selter Cliffs nature reserve is designed to protect valuable habitats, including caves for bats and areas for threatened bird species. While specific sightings are never guaranteed, these protected areas offer a higher chance of observing local wildlife in their natural environment.
